For a standard-sized home in Perryopolis, a full window replacement typically ranges from $8,000 to $20,000, depending on the number and size of windows. Key cost factors include the window material (vinyl, wood, or composite), the style (double-hung, casement, etc.), and the energy efficiency features, which are crucial for our Pennsylvania climate with cold winters. Labor costs can also vary based on the complexity of your home's architecture and whether any structural repairs to old frames are needed.
The ideal times are late spring (May-June) and early fall (September-October). These periods offer mild, dry weather in Southwestern Pennsylvania, which is optimal for installation and allows for proper sealing. While installations can be done year-round, scheduling in these off-peak seasons often provides better availability and may avoid the high demand of late summer. Winter installations are possible but require extra precautions from the installer to manage indoor temperatures and seal the home quickly.
Yes, Pennsylvania adheres to the 2021 International Residential Code (IRC), which includes specific requirements for window energy performance. For Perryopolis, located in Climate Zone 5, it's highly recommended to choose windows with a low U-factor (for heat loss) and a low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C) to improve winter comfort and summer cooling efficiency. Look for the ENERGY STAR® label certified for the North-Central zone, as this ensures the product meets strict, climate-specific performance criteria set by the EPA.

Older homes in Perryopolis, including many with historic character, often have uneven frames, lead paint, or structural settling. A professional installer should conduct a thorough inspection to plan for necessary repairs or custom-sized replacement windows. It's also critical to discuss proper weatherization and flashing details to prevent air and water infiltration, which is a common issue in our region's older structures. Preserving the architectural integrity while improving efficiency is a key balance to strike.
